On December 25, information from the People's Committee of Thanh Hoa province said that the Vice Chairman of the People's Committee of Dau Thanh Tung province has just signed a decision to establish the Management Board of the Ho Dinh Thanh and key relics of the province, under the Department of Culture, Sports and Tourism.

According to the decision, the Management Board of the Ho Dynasty Citadel and key relics of the province was established on the basis of reorganizing the Ho Dynasty Citadel Heritage Conservation Center; at the same time, receiving the functions and tasks of managing the Lam Kinh Special National Historical Site and the Ba Trieu Special National Architectural and Artistic Site from the Thanh Hoa Heritage Research and Conservation Center.
In addition, the Board is assigned the function and task of managing the National Historical - Scenic Landscape Landscape Site of Ba Trieu Uprising (including Nui Nua, Denua, Am Tien) and managing the special-use forest associated with historical relics.
The Management Board is a public service unit that collects and self-guarantee a part of regular expenditures; has the function of comprehensively protecting and preserving the World Heritage Site of the Imperial Citadel and key relics assigned for management; scientific research; restoration and embellishment of relics; restoration and embellishment of artifacts; landscape protection, environmental control; explanation and education; museum and library activities; art performances, intangible cultural heritage performances; communication, foreign affairs; consulting on conservation, project management and community cooperation.
The Management Board has legal status, its own seal and account; the head office is located at the World Heritage Site of Hanoi Citadel (in Tay Do commune). The affiliated facilities include: Lam Kinh Special National Historical Site (Lam Son Commune); Ba Trieu Special National Historical and Artistic Site (Trieu Loc Commune); National Historical Site - Scenic Landscape Site of Ba Trieu Uprising (Nui Nua, Denua, Am Tien), located in Tan Ninh, Mau Lam, Trung Chinh communes, Thanh Hoa province.
